Mid-Century Gouda Ware Serving Peanut Bowl with 6 Little Bowls

About the Item

Very stylish Mid-Century peanut set in pretty pastel colors made by Royal Gouda Pottery. The pottery was founded in 1898 by Adrianus Jonker. In 1930 the pottery got the predicate Royal. In 1915 during World Exhibition in San Francisco, Gouda Plateelbakkerij or Pottery exhibited in the "Palace of Varied Industries". After the successful exhibition some pottery works were bought by an American entrepreneur Edmond Torlotting. He had a showroom in New York and sold the pottery as Gouda Ware (Matte Plateel) with success. In 1965 the pottery closed.
